Real Madrid has had the luxury of a core group of players who have been regulars in the squad for years. Unlike, many clubs, Real Madrid has had the likes of Luka Modric, Toni Kroos, Casemiro, Dani Carvajal, and Karim Benzema regularly starting for the last eight years.

However, a changing of the guards is on the not-so-distant horizon.

Modric is 36 and will more than likely hang up his boots in the summer of 2023. The Big Benz just turned 34 in December, Kroos is 32, and Casemiro is 29.

While it may be tough to see these club legends nearing the end of their playing career, Real Madrid has meticulously planned and prepared for when these names decide it is time to move on.

Los Blancos are lucky to have a plethora of young players among the ranks who can step in to fill the void left by some of these legends.

Vinicius Junior

I’m sure it comes as little surprise seeing the prolific Brazilian winger first on the list.

What Vini has accomplished so far this season has already outdone everything he did in the previous three years with the club! His 12 league goals are more than he scored in 82 appearances and over 3,000 minutes between 2018 and the spring of ’21.

Watching the winger after his move from Flamengo, it was clear from the offset that he had all the fundamentals and skill needed to be an elite winger, the only problem was his decision-making in the final third.

He would panic with the ball at his feet in the box and often failed to even hit the target. Working with a sports psychologist and forming a telepathic connection with Benzema in the middle, Vini Jr. is figuring everything out.

His scintillating form, combined with that of Benzema, is giving Madridistas hope that Vinicius Junior could one day be compared to the likes of Neymar and perhaps a future Real Madrid player, Kylian Mbappe.

The jump we have seen in the span of four months from Vini indicates to me that he is just starting to crack the code in Spain, meaning we haven’t seen the best from this young man yet!
